A leading management recruitment consultancy in the United Kingdom is seeking a qualified Radiographer (RT) to join an inspection team. Ideal candidates will hold RT Level 1 or Level 2 certification.

Responsibilities include:

  • Performing Radiographic Testing in compliance with industry standards
  • Maintaining accurate records
  • Ensuring safety procedures

This position offers a competitive salary and the opportunity to work within a UKAS accredited environment.
